The effects of pre-treatment with a novel PFC emulsion on PDT-induced tumor necrosis have been studied in mice. Injection of emulsion either 2.5 hr or 24 hr before PDT did not affect the depth of tumour necrosis. However, pre-treatment with the emulsion appeared to protect skin against photodynamic damage although the mechanism(s) and active principle(s) involved were not identified. These results suggest that there may be specific advantages in using emulsified PFCs in conjunction with PDT which may be independent of changes in tumour oxygenation.
